Jota made his big move to Celtic from Rennes this week after weeks of speculation.

Celtic announced the Jota deal yesterday afternoon and the news upset the Rennes fans who raged at their club for allowing the Portuguese winger to return to Celtic Park.

Jota spent two incredible years at Celtic before he left in the summer of 2023 to make a £25m move from the Bhoys to Al-Ittihad.

Now back in Paradise, Jota has sent his first message to the Celtic fans with whom he enjoyed a close bond in his first spell at the club.

Jota ‘very happy’ as he delivers message to Celtic fans about Bhoys return

Short and sweet, Jota looked overjoyed as the Portuguese winger too to Celtic’s YouTube channel to deliver his first message to the Hoops support.

Jota said, “Hello, Celtic fans, this is Jota. Very happy to be back and I can’t wait to see you all in Paradise. See you soon.”

Jota could make his Celtic debut against Motherwell this weekend as the 25-year-old looks to get his career back on track after disastrous spells in Ligue 1 and the Saudi Pro League.

Three goals Jota scored at Celtic vs Rangers will have fans drooling at his return

In his first spell at Celtic, Jota scored 28 goals that helped to deliver five trophies out of six under Ange Postecoglou. Four of those were against Rangers.

Here, 67 Hail Hail picks Jota’s best three goals against Rangers during the Portuguese winger’s first Celtic stint that will have fans excited at his return.

Jota’s award-winning goal in Celtic’s 4-0 win vs Rangers

Jota’s award-winning Celtic goal against Rangers in the 4-0 drubbing of the Ibrox helped the Hoops wrap up the league title that contributed to a record-breaking eighth domestic treble.

The goal also saw the Portuguese star deliver his iconic goal celebration.

Jota mugs Rangers in Celtic’s 3-2 Parkhead win

The Portuguese winger was alert and pounced on a horror mistake by Rangers defender, John Souttar, as he tucked home from a tight angle in a Celtic win over Rangers.

Celtic went on to win the game and seal yet another league title.

Jota breaks Rangers’ hearts in the Scottish Cup with Celtic winner

And to finalise the best of Jota’s Celtic goals against Rangers, this one in the 2023 Scottish Cup semi-final epitomised just how dangerous the Hoops winger was against the Ibrox club.

Celtic went on to win the tournament and the treble that season to put Jota and many of his teammates’ names into the Parkhead history books.
